A little about me

Hi! My name is Cassi, and I am passionate about helping individuals come home to themselves. Healing often involves rediscovering who we are beneath the protective patterns and adaptations that once served us. Together, we will explore the deeper roots of your struggles while cultivating greater self-understanding, emotional regulation, and connection to your authentic self.

My approach is warm, collaborative, and tailored to each client's unique story. I am EMDR-trained and integrate attachment-focused EMDR, Polyvagal Theory, Internal Family Systems (IFS)-informed work, mindfulness, and evidence-based interventions to support meaningful growth and lasting change. I strive to create a space where clients feel safe enough to approach difficult experiences with curiosity, compassion, and intention.

I am particularly passionate about EMDR Intensives because they provide the time and space to engage in deeper healing within a structured and supportive format. My approach prioritizes safety, attunement, and thoughtful integration throughout the process.

My hope is to help clients cultivate greater authenticity, self-trust, and connection as they move toward a life that feels aligned with their values and goals. When you're ready, I would love to meet you!
